The vibe I get off this is great, and the beat is nice. Work on some cooler modulated bass lines.
Not all dubstep needs dirty bass, and a sexy ass wobble. But it'd make this track sicker.
My last suggestion is to gather some better drum sounds.
They sound good nice, but they don't sound as if they fit together.
